MAXIMUM AGE

As of 30 July 2021, candidates for the Bachelor of Design (B.Des) programme may not be older than 20 years. Candidates from the reserved category will have their upper age limit relaxed by three years.

Candidates from the General Category who were born on or before July 1, 2001, are ineligible to apply for this Bachelor's degree programme.

Candidates from the reserved categories (OBC-NCL, SC, ST, and PH) who were born on or before July 1, 1996 are ineligible to apply for this bachelor's programme.

ABOUT NID 

NID is widely recognised as the best Indian institution for product design, product concept creation, and design innovation. NID instructs students in design and art, aesthetic sensibility, and design engineering principles. It focuses on product development, art, and aesthetics.

NID, which was founded in 1961, is renowned as being the most competitive design school in India. It only has 275 seats available in its M. Des programme and only about 100 seats in its B. Des programmes.

It is a legally recognised institution run by the Indian government's DPIIT, Ministry of Commerce and Industry. Due to the National Institute of Design Act of 2014, it has been designated by an Act of Parliament as a "Institution of National Importance."

NID is solely focused on design fields. There aren't many courses specifically focused on fashion. People work extensively in every design-related field, including fashion, motor vehicles, lifestyle, architecture, movies, cartoons, communication, and many more. They do not only focus on the fashion industry.
